Skip-Bo is a commercial version of the card game Spite and Malice, a derivative of Russian Bank (also known as Crapette or Tunj), which in turn originates from Double Klondike (also called Double Solitaire ). (SKIP-BO® cards don’t count.) The deal moves to the left after each game. When there are 2 to 4 players, the dealer deals 30 cards to each player. With 5 or more players, 20 cards are dealt. The cards are dealt face down and they become your STOCK pile. Each player turns the top card of his/her STOCK pile

On a player’s turn, they draw one card from the deck and play one.Card Types. Skip-Bo is a simple card game that is based on sequencing the numbers, and there are 162 cards in the box. There are only two types of cards in the game. Numbered cards from 1-12, and Skip-Bo cards (which behave like Wild cards). The numbered cards are colored blue (from 1-4), green (from 5-8) and red (from 9-12).Skip-Bo is a popular fun card game, also known as Spite and Malice or Cat and Mouse. The game’s goal is to play all the stockpile cards in numerical sequence.Draw Pile: After the deal, the remaining cards are placed facedown in the center of the table to form the DRAW pile. Building Piles: During play, up to four BUILDING piles can be started. Only a 1 or a SKIP-BO® card (or the equivalent result on the die) can start a BUILDING pile.
